Understanding Osteopenia and Osteoporosis
Bone density exists on a spectrum. Normal bone density means your bones are strong and dense. Osteopenia is the middle ground, where bone density is lower than normal but not yet low enough to be called osteoporosis. Osteoporosis is significantly reduced bone density, with high fracture risk.
The numbers: Bone density is measured by T score on a DEXA scan. Normal is above negative 1.0. Osteopenia is between negative 1.0 and negative 2.5. Osteoporosis is below negative 2.5.
Think of osteopenia as a warning sign. Your bones have weakened, but you have the opportunity to intervene before reaching osteoporosis. And even if you already have osteoporosis, you can still improve bone density and reduce fracture risk.
Who’s at risk? Postmenopausal women are at highest risk due to declining estrogen, which plays a crucial role in bone maintenance. But men can develop osteopenia too, especially as they age. Other risk factors include family history, small body frame, sedentary lifestyle, smoking, excessive alcohol use, and certain medications.
What the Research Says About Exercise and Bone
The evidence supporting exercise for bone health is robust and compelling:
Strength Training Increases Bone Density
A landmark systematic review published in the Journal of Bone and Mineral Research found that resistance training significantly increases bone mineral density at the spine and hip, the two sites most vulnerable to osteoporotic fractures.
Research in the British Journal of Sports Medicine (BJSM) examining exercise interventions for osteoporosis found that progressive resistance training produces the greatest improvements in bone density compared to other exercise types.
A study published in the Journal of the American Medical Association (JAMA) followed postmenopausal women doing high intensity resistance training and found significant improvements in bone density, along with improved muscle strength and balance.
Higher Intensity Produces Better Results
Here’s something important: not all exercise is equally effective for bones. Research consistently shows that higher intensity loading produces greater bone adaptations.
A systematic review in BJSM found that exercises must exceed a certain threshold of intensity to stimulate bone formation. Walking and light exercise, while beneficial for overall health, produce minimal bone density improvements. Higher load exercises like barbell training produce significantly better results.
Research published in the Journal of Strength and Conditioning Research found that programs using heavier weights and compound movements (squats, deadlifts, presses) produced superior bone outcomes compared to light weight, high repetition programs.
Exercise Reduces Fracture Risk Beyond Bone Density
Bone density is only part of the fracture risk equation. Falls cause most osteoporotic fractures, and exercise dramatically reduces fall risk.
A Cochrane Review found that exercise programs reduce fall rates by approximately 23% in older adults. Strength and balance training are particularly effective.
Even if exercise didn’t improve bone density at all (which it does), it would still reduce fracture risk by improving strength, balance, and reaction time. Research in the International Journal of Sports Physical Therapy (IJSPT) has shown that strength training improves multiple fall risk factors simultaneously.

Progressive Loading
Bones respond to mechanical stress. When you load a bone, specialized cells detect the stress and signal for new bone formation. This process, called mechanotransduction, requires sufficient loading to trigger adaptation.
Barbell training allows for precise, progressive loading. You can start with just the bar (typically 45 pounds) or lighter, and add weight gradually as you get stronger. This progressive approach ensures you’re always providing enough stimulus for bone adaptation while staying safe.
Multi Joint Movements
The exercises we emphasize (squats, deadlifts, presses, rows) load multiple bones and joints simultaneously. A squat, for example, loads the spine, hips, and legs all at once. This efficient approach builds bone density throughout the skeleton, not just in isolated areas.
Research in the AJSM has shown that compound barbell movements produce greater bone loading than single joint exercises or machines.
Specificity to High Risk Sites
The spine and hip are the most dangerous sites for osteoporotic fractures. Hip fractures in particular are associated with significant morbidity and mortality in older adults.
Barbell exercises like squats and deadlifts directly load the spine and hips. Research in BJSM has shown that exercises that load specific skeletal sites produce the greatest bone improvements at those sites.

Builds Muscle Alongside Bone
Strength training doesn’t just build bone; it builds muscle. This matters because sarcopenia (age related muscle loss) often accompanies osteopenia. Research in JAMA has shown that muscle mass and bone density are closely linked. Building muscle supports bone, and both contribute to reduced fall and fracture risk.

Safety Considerations
Understandably, people with osteopenia or osteoporosis worry about safety. Won’t lifting weights increase fracture risk?
Research actually shows the opposite. When performed with proper technique and appropriate progression, strength training is remarkably safe, even for people with low bone density.
A systematic review in BJSM examining adverse events in exercise trials for osteoporosis found that properly supervised resistance training has very low injury rates. The benefits far outweigh the risks.
Key safety principles we follow:
Proper technique. We teach correct form before adding load. Good technique distributes stress appropriately and protects the spine.
Gradual progression. We increase weight slowly over time, allowing bones, muscles, and connective tissue to adapt.
Avoiding high risk movements. We minimize loaded spinal flexion (bending forward under load) and other movements that could increase fracture risk for those with significant bone loss.
